Ensaimadas with orange flower and cinnamon
Bread-machine ensaimadas — sweet spiral rolls flavoured with cinnamon and orange flower, dusted with icing sugar (Programme 6).

Instructions
PROG. 6. Time: 2h02 (4 ensaimadas) / 2h59 (8 ensaimadas).
Quantities per batch:
- Milk: 40 ml (4 ensaimadas) / 120 ml (8 ensaimadas)
- Egg: 1 / 1
- Salt: ½ c.c. / 1 c.c.
- Oil: 1.5 c.s. / 3 c.s.
- Butter: 35 g / 70 g
- Powdered sugar: 2½ c.s. / 4½ c.s.
- Ground cinnamon: ½ c.c. / 1 c.c.
- Orange flower: ½ c.c. / 1 c.c.
- Flour: 190 g / 350 g
- Dried baker's yeast: 1½ c.c. / 2 c.c.
- For decoration: icing sugar
Add the ingredients to the bread pan in the following order: milk, salt, olive oil, melted butter and brown sugar. Then add the flour, cinnamon, orange flower and yeast. Place the bread pan in the machine. Select programme 6, the desired crust colour and press the "Start/Stop" button. When the beep sounds for the second time (after 1 hr 05), open the machine and remove the dough. If you are making 8 ensaimadas, separate the dough into 2 portions and keep one of them under a cloth for your 2nd batch. Divide the 1st batch into 4 equal parts and then roll the dough into coils of 15 to 20 cm. Gently roll the coils out, then roll it up into a spiral. Place the ensaimadas on the flat baking rack and glaze with water using a pastry brush. Press the «Start/Stop» button again. When the beep sounds again (after 57 minutes), remove the ensaimaidas and then repeat the procedure to start off your 2nd batch. When baked, sprinkle with icing sugar and leave to cool on a rack.
Tip: opt for a light crust colour.
